How Synthetic ETFs Work: Swaps, Counterparty Risk, and Taxes

A synthetic ETF tracks an index without owning the securities in it. Instead of buying the index’s stocks or bonds, the fund holds a separate basket of assets and enters into a total return swap with a bank: the fund pays the bank whatever its basket returns, and the bank pays the fund the return of the target index. That contract is what delivers the performance you see. Understanding how synthetic ETFs work means understanding that trade — cheaper access and tighter tracking, in exchange for a layer of counterparty risk that a physical ETF doesn’t carry.

What the Fund Owns vs. What It Tracks

A physical S&P 500 ETF owns the 500 stocks. A synthetic one doesn’t. It holds what’s called a substitute basket, or reference basket, whose contents may have nothing to do with the index being tracked. A synthetic commodity index ETF, for example, might hold European government bonds or large-cap equities.1MoneySense. Guide to ETFs: How Synthetic ETFs Work

That basket serves two purposes: it’s an asset the fund can point to, and it’s the raw material fed into the swap. The index performance itself is delivered by the derivative sitting on top.2Federal Reserve. Synthetic ETFs The separation between what the fund owns and what it tracks is the defining feature of the structure, and it drives every advantage and every risk that follows.

The Total Return Swap Does the Work

The engine is a bilateral contract, usually with a large investment bank. It has two legs. The ETF pays the counterparty the return of the substitute basket. The counterparty pays the ETF the total return of the target index, dividends and capital gains included.2Federal Reserve. Synthetic ETFs

The bank earns a swap spread for providing the exposure and hedges its own side however it wants — trading the underlying market, using other derivatives, netting against other client business. The investor doesn’t see any of that. What the investor sees is an ETF price that moves with the index.

The swap is valued every day. When the index rises, the counterparty owes the fund more, and exposure to that counterparty grows. When the index falls, exposure shrinks or flips the other way. That daily valuation is what triggers the resets and collateral movements described further down.

Unfunded and Funded Structures

Synthetic ETFs come in two variants, and the difference matters if a counterparty fails.

In the unfunded model, investor cash goes into the substitute basket, which the ETF owns outright. The fund then swaps the basket’s return for the index return. If the counterparty defaults, the fund still legally holds those basket assets and can sell them.1MoneySense. Guide to ETFs: How Synthetic ETFs Work

In the funded model, investor cash goes to the counterparty itself. The counterparty posts collateral with an independent custodian, pledged in the ETF’s favor. The fund doesn’t own the collateral directly; it has a claim on it, and reaching that collateral in a default means working through the custodian.1MoneySense. Guide to ETFs: How Synthetic ETFs Work

Most European synthetic ETFs use the unfunded structure. Direct ownership of an asset basket is a stronger starting position than a pledged claim.

Why Anyone Uses This Structure

Synthetic replication exists because it solves problems physical funds handle badly.

  • Market access. Some indexes cover markets where buying and settling local securities is expensive, slow, or legally awkward. A swap lets the ETF track those markets without touching them; the counterparty deals with the local mechanics.
  • Tracking precision. Physical ETFs deal with transaction costs, cash drag from uninvested dividends, and rebalancing friction. A synthetic fund’s return is defined by contract, which tends to produce smaller tracking error.
  • Dividend withholding. A European-domiciled physical ETF holding US stocks generally pays withholding tax on the US dividends it receives. A synthetic ETF that swaps into a qualifying US index may avoid that withholding, which for a broad US equity fund can be worth more than the swap spread costs.

None of this is free. The price is the swap spread the bank charges and the counterparty risk built into the arrangement.

The Counterparty Risk You’re Actually Taking

If the swap counterparty fails, the fund loses the performance stream the counterparty owed. It doesn’t lose everything. In the unfunded model it still has the substitute basket; in the funded model it has a claim against the pledged collateral. The real loss in a default is the gap between what the counterparty owed on the swap and what the fund can recover from those assets.2Federal Reserve. Synthetic ETFs

That gap is the net mark-to-market value of the swap. If the index has climbed a lot since the last reset, the counterparty owes the fund a lot, and the exposure is larger. If the index has fallen, the fund may owe the counterparty, and there’s effectively no counterparty risk in that moment. The dangerous scenario is a sudden failure while the swap has a large positive value for the fund — which is precisely what the UCITS rules are designed to contain.

How the Rules Keep That Risk Small

Under the UCITS directive, a fund’s net exposure to any single over-the-counter derivative counterparty is capped at 10% of assets when the counterparty is a credit institution, and 5% otherwise.3European Securities and Markets Authority. UCITS Directive Article 52 In practice, that cap is enforced by resetting the swap. When the counterparty’s net obligation crosses the trigger, it moves additional securities into the substitute basket to bring net exposure back toward zero. Most ETF providers set their internal trigger below the 10% regulatory ceiling so a market move doesn’t push them over. During volatile stretches, resets happen frequently.

Collateral Quality

ESMA guidelines set strict criteria on the collateral a counterparty posts. It must be highly liquid, priced transparently on a regulated market, valued daily, and issued by an entity independent of the counterparty. That independence rule matters because collateral from the counterparty’s own group would be worthless in exactly the moment it’s needed.4European Securities and Markets Authority. ESMA Guidelines for Competent Authorities and UCITS Management Companies

The collateral basket must also be diversified. No single issuer can account for more than 20% of the fund’s net asset value, with a specific carve-out that allows fully government-collateralized structures if the debt comes from at least six different issuers and no single issue exceeds 30% of NAV.4European Securities and Markets Authority. ESMA Guidelines for Competent Authorities and UCITS Management Companies

Haircuts and Overcollateralization

A haircut discounts collateral to account for price volatility and liquidation costs. A government bond posted at $100 with a 5% haircut counts as $95 toward the collateral requirement, building a cushion against price moves during a liquidation.

Many providers go further and overcollateralize, holding collateral worth more than the net swap exposure. This isn’t mandated at a specific level; it’s a competitive practice among major European issuers.

Multiple Counterparties

Some providers split the swap across several banks rather than relying on one. A default then affects only the portion assigned to that bank. This has been standard practice at several large European synthetic ETF issuers since 2009.

Availability in the United States

Synthetic ETFs are rare in the US. The Investment Company Act of 1940 limits how much registered funds can rely on derivatives to replicate an index, and for years the SEC deferred exemptive requests for new derivative-heavy ETFs while it reviewed the issue.5U.S. Securities and Exchange Commission. Testimony on Market Micro-Structure: An Examination of ETFs

The current framework is Rule 18f-4. Funds using derivatives must run a derivatives risk management program and meet a leverage limit tied to value at risk: generally, fund VaR cannot exceed 200% of a designated reference portfolio’s VaR, with an absolute VaR test capping exposure at 20% of net assets.6U.S. Securities and Exchange Commission. Use of Derivatives by Registered Investment Companies and Business Development Companies – Small Entity Compliance Guide A handful of US-domiciled synthetic ETFs now operate under this rule, but they’re a small slice of the US market.

Tax Friction That Can Undo the Appeal

The tax treatment of a synthetic ETF depends heavily on where you live and where the fund is domiciled.

US Investors and PFIC Rules

Most European UCITS ETFs, physical or synthetic, qualify as passive foreign investment companies under US tax law. A foreign entity is a PFIC if at least 75% of its gross income is passive or at least 50% of its assets produce passive income — thresholds investment funds almost always cross. Consequences include potentially higher tax rates than long-term capital gains, interest charges on deferred gains, and a Form 8621 filing every year you hold the fund.7Internal Revenue Service. About Form 8621, Information Return by a Shareholder of a Passive Foreign Investment Company or Qualified Electing Fund

A mark-to-market election lets you recognize unrealized gains annually as ordinary income, simplifying things somewhat but not eliminating the annual filing. The more favorable qualified electing fund election generally isn’t available because European managers don’t produce the annual PFIC statements the IRS requires.

Non-US Investors and Section 871(m)

Section 871(m) imposes a 30% withholding tax on “dividend equivalent payments” from derivatives referencing US equities. A European synthetic ETF that swaps into a US index can, in principle, face withholding on the dividend component of the swap even though it never holds the shares.8DTCC. 871(m) Announcements – Global Tax Services

There’s a significant exception for derivatives on a “qualified index,” a category that covers most broad-based US market indexes. A synthetic S&P 500 ETF using a qualified-index swap can avoid 871(m) entirely, and that exception is a large part of why synthetic US-equity trackers remain popular with European investors.

The practical decision usually sits at the intersection of these tax rules and the structural mechanics. A European investor choosing between a physical and synthetic S&P 500 fund is weighing tracking precision and avoided dividend withholding against counterparty exposure. A US investor eyeing a European synthetic ETF has to weigh the PFIC compliance burden first, before any of the structural advantages come into play.
